For the first time in almost two months, the troubled Britney Spears was reunited with her little sons – for about three hours – on Saturday.

After lawyers for Spears and Kevin Federline reached a visitation agreement Friday, the star saw her children Sean Preston, 2, and Jayden James, 1.

Britney and K-Fed hammered out a new visitation deal.

The boys left Kevin Federline’s Tarzana, Calif., house Saturday morning – put in their car seats by their father, according to photographers – and were driven by FedEx’s bodyguard to Spears’ home in Studio City.

A source involved in the case says, “The real hero was [Britney Spears‘ father] Jamie. He has taken charge, and she has visitation again.”

Sources say Jamie Spears and Britney’s psychiatrist were present for the visit – two requirements agreed upon by both sides’ lawyers in court.

After a three-hour stay, Britney Spears’ sons left again in the back of Federline’s grey Dodge truck, which was driven by his bodyguard.
